Uganda/Tanzania: Hayatou to Preside Over Cecafa Cup

THE Confederation of African Football (CAF) president Issa Hayatou will preside over the official opening of this year’s Cecafa Senior Challenge Cup due in Kampala next weekend.

The Continental football leader is expected in Kampala on Thursday, said a statement issued by the Council of East and Central Africa Football Association (CECAFA).

“His (Hayatou’s) visit is partly in recognition of CECAFA’s continued stable development of the game of football in the region,” read the statement. Hayatou’s visit follows an invitation extended to him by the CECAFA President Leodgar Tenga.

The CAF president will be accompanied by several CAF officials, including the General Secretary Hicham El Amrani. Other confirmed members of the delegation are Mohamed Raouraoua, Constant Omari and Ngangue Appolinaire.

During his stay in Uganda, the CAF President will attend the CECAFA Congress at Serena Hotel on Friday, before presiding over the official opening of the regional club championship at Namboole stadium the following evening
